I currently have two steamers- one is a continuous fill Daimer 1500C and the other is a DeLonghi that is *not* continuous fill and that puts out about 75pis. NO comparison between the two IME, best I can say about the DeLonghi is that it's better than nothing and nicer than, say... a SteamBuggy.



-I find continuous fill to be almost an absolute necessity, and I'm not using mine in a commercial environment either



-I'd want a lot more PSI than 65; that I ended up buying my Daimer 1500C out of frustration and the additional oomph was well worth the cost. 75psi simply can't do things that 89psi can. And even my Daimer isn't much compared to the huge propane-powered steamer we had at the dealership. "More steamer than you need" is, IMO, barely enough ;)
